This must be in West Texas/Eastern New Mexico where the altitude is like 4,000 Feet. I know this because I lived in Clovis New Mexico for 3 years. Because of that altitude and commonly 6500-7000DA, N/A cars do not run to well up there.

There is no way a H/C/I 100 shot Camaro SS LS1 is going to be door to door/ losing to a ported eaton cobra with boltons at sea level; unless poor driver of course. At sea level that cobra would be lunch meat against that same Fbody. All in all good runs for sure. Forced Induction is nice to have at high altitude.
